Meighan Boyd is a scholar working on Atmospheric Science, Archeology and Earth-Surface Processes. According to data from OpenAlex, Meighan Boyd has authored 9 papers receiving a total of 504 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Atmospheric Science, 5 papers in Archeology and 3 papers in Earth-Surface Processes. Recurrent topics in Meighan Boyd's work include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(5 papers), Maritime and Coastal Archaeology (4 papers) and Geological formations and processes (2 papers). Meighan Boyd is often cited by papers focused on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(5 papers), Maritime and Coastal Archaeology (4 papers) and Geological formations and processes (2 papers). Meighan Boyd coll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Sweden. Meighan Boyd's co-authors include Karin Holmgren, Martin Finné, Simon Brewer, Katherine J. Willis, Kenji Izumi, I. Colin Prentice, Sandy P. Harrison, Ines Heßler, Sharon R. Stocker and Patrick J. Bartlein and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Geochimica et Cosmochimica Acta and The Science of The Total Environment.

All Works

9 of 9 papers shown
1.
Mattey, D. P., et al.. (2021). External controls on CO2 in Gibraltar cave air and ground air: Implications for interpretation of δ13C in speleothems. The Science of The Total Environment. 777. 146096–146096. 14 indexed citations
2.
Fohlmeister, Jens, Ny Riavo G. Voarintsoa, Franziska A. Lechleitner, et al.. (2020). Main controls on the stable carbon isotope composition of speleothems. Geochimica et Cosmochimica Acta. 279. 67–87. 122 indexed citations
3.
Boyd, Meighan, Dirk L. Hoffmann, Tim Atkinson, Wolfgang Müller, & D. P. Mattey. (2019). Constraints from monitoring on reconstruction of Gibraltar palaeoclimate in a speleothem record covering the last glacial period. EGU General Assembly Conference Abstracts. 15798. 1 indexed citations
4.
Finné, Martin, Karin Holmgren, Chuan‐Chou Shen, et al.. (2017). Late Bronze Age climate change and the destruction of the Mycenaean Palace of Nestor at Pylos. PLoS ONE. 12(12). e0189447–e0189447. 76 indexed citations
5.
Weiberg, Erika, Ingmar Unkel, Katerina Kouli, et al.. (2016). The socio-environmental history of the Peloponnese during the Holocene: Towards an integrated understanding of the past. Quaternary Science Reviews. 136. 40–65. 84 indexed citations
6.
Boyd, Meighan. (2015). Speleothems from Warm Climates : Holocene Records from the Caribbean and Mediterranean Regions. KTH Publication Database DiVA (KTH Royal Institute of Technology). 22 indexed citations
7.
Finné, Martin, Malin E. Kylander, Meighan Boyd, H. S. Sundqvist, & Ludvig Löwemark. (2014). Can XRF scanning of speleothems be used as a non-destructive method to identify paleoflood events in caves?. International Journal of Speleology. 44(1). 17–23. 22 indexed citations
8.
Harrison, Sandy P., Patrick J. Bartlein, Simon Brewer, et al.. (2013). Climate model benchmarking with glacial and mid-Holocene climates. Climate Dynamics. 43(3-4). 671–688. 162 indexed citations
9.
Thomas, David J., Meighan Boyd, Kenneth L. Crowell, et al.. (2011). A Biological Inventory of Meacham Cave (Independence County, Arkansas). Journal of the Arkansas Academy of Science. 65. 1 indexed citations
